Expert AI · Mechanic's Insight
The vehicle presents an exemplary record of roadworthiness, maintaining a consistently stable maintenance trend across its documented history. The most recent inspection conducted on 16 July 2025 at 14,695 miles passed with zero defects or advisories. This mirrors the clean results seen in 2022 through 2024, indicating the car has been maintained to high standards without recurring mechanical or structural failures. The mileage pattern is exceptionally low for a seven-year-old vehicle, averaging approximately 2,100 miles per year. Between July 2022 at 5,707 miles and July 2025 at 14,695 miles, the car covered only 8,988 miles over three years. While this suggests very light use of the engine, it also indicates the vehicle may have sat for extended periods between tests. Such low mileage typically reduces wear on the drivetrain and suspension components, but it introduces risks related to fluid degradation and flat-spotting that MOT tests cannot detect. Given the pristine MOT history, a buyer should focus their in-person inspection on specific areas associated with low-mileage luxury vehicles. You must check for signs of surface corrosion on brake discs and caliper seizing, which often occur when a car is not driven frequently. Inspect the tyre sidewalls for cracking or dry rot despite deep tread depth, as rubber ages over time regardless of distance driven. Additionally, verify that the air suspension system and bushings have not perished or leaked, as these components can degrade during long periods of stationary storage.
